Email Marketing Tips
To optimize email marketing efforts similar to this example, consider the following tips:
- Personalized Content: Tailor emails based on customer behavior and preferences, making them feel more relevant.
- A/B Testing: Experiment with different subject lines and content to identify what resonates best with your audience.
- Mobile Optimization: Ensure that emails are easily readable on mobile devices, given the increasing number of users accessing emails via smartphones.
- Follow Up: Create a series of follow-up emails for customers who engage with your content but do not convert immediately.
- Analytics Tracking: Monitor open rates, click-through rates, and conversions to assess the effectiveness of your campaigns.
